74VHCT245AFT Overview
- The 74VHCT245AFT is a part of the VHCT family of logic devices that provide high-speed operation with low power consumption.
- It has 8 bidirectional data lines that can be used for interfacing between different voltage systems or for high-speed data transfer in digital systems.
- The device has a wide operating voltage range of 4.5V to 5.5V and a high-speed propagation delay of 4.5ns, making it suitable for applications that require fast data transfer.
- The 74VHCT245AFT can be used for memory address latching, bus isolation and buffering, and other applications that require bidirectional data transfer with ESD protection.
Features
- 8-bit bidirectional data transfer
- Wide operating voltage range: 4.5V to 5.5V
- High-speed propagation delay: 4.5ns
- Output drive capability: +/- 8mA
- ESD protection: 2000V HBM, 200V MM
Applications
- Interfacing between different voltage systems
- High-speed data transfer in digital systems
- Memory address latching
- Bus isolation and buffering
